In today's competitive marketplace, retaining customers is more important than ever. Customer success (CS) is the practice of maximizing customer satisfaction, loyalty, and ultimately, revenue by ensuring that customers are using your product or service to achieve their goals. A strong CS strategy can help you reduce churn, increase customer lifetime value, and boost your bottom line.

Here are 15 effective customer success strategies that can help you achieve your business goals in 2023:
1. Understand your customer's journey
The first step to creating a successful customer success strategy is to understand your customer's journey. This includes understanding their needs, pain points, and expectations at each stage of their relationship with your company. You can gather this information through customer surveys, interviews, and user research.
2. Define success metrics
Once you understand your customer's journey, you need to define success metrics. These metrics will help you track your progress and measure the effectiveness of your CS initiatives. Common CS metrics include customer satisfaction, churn rate, customer lifetime value, and Net Promoter Score (NPS).
3. Provide a personalized onboarding experience
Onboarding is the critical first step in the customer journey. It is the time when you introduce your product or service to your customers and help them get started using it. A personalized onboarding experience will increase customer engagement and satisfaction.
4. Offer ongoing support
Customers need support throughout their journey, not just at the beginning. Offer ongoing support through various channels, such as email, phone, chat, and self-service resources. Make sure your support team is knowledgeable, responsive, and helpful.
5. Identify and address churn risks
Churn is the loss of customers. It is important to identify and address churn risks early on. This can be done by monitoring customer usage patterns, analyzing customer feedback, and conducting churn surveys.
6. Proactively engage with customers
Don't wait for customers to come to you with problems. Proactively engage with them by providing valuable content, offering training, and inviting them to participate in surveys and feedback opportunities.
7. Track and measure KPIs
Regularly track and measure your CS KPIs. This will help you identify areas for improvement and make data-driven decisions.
8. Use technology to automate and streamline processes
There are many great tools available to help you automate and streamline your CS processes. This can free up your team to focus on more strategic initiatives.
9. Collaborate with sales and marketing
Sales and marketing play a critical role in customer success. Make sure they are aligned with your CS goals and that they are providing the right information to customers.
10. Foster a culture of customer-centricity
Customer-centricity is the belief that the customer is at the center of everything you do. Make sure your company culture is customer-centric by encouraging open communication, valuing customer feedback, and rewarding customer-focused behavior.
